Creamy BLT Pasta Salad Recipe with Bacon Ranch Dressing Easy and Best

creamy BLT pasta salad - featured image

A creamy yet light BLT pasta salad featuring crispy bacon, fresh veggies, and a smoky homemade bacon ranch dressing. Perfect for summer gatherings and quick meals.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 8 oz rotini or bowtie pasta
  • 6 slices thick-cut bacon
  • 2 cups c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1 cup romaine lettuce, chopped
  • ½ cup red onion, finely diced
  • 1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ese (optional)
  • ½ cup mayonnaise
  • ¼ cup sour cream or Greek yogurt
  • 2 tbsp buttermilk or regular milk plus 1 tsp lemon juice
  • 2 tbsp fresh parsley, finely chopped
  • 1 tsp dried dill or 1 tbsp fresh dill, chopped
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• ½ tsp smoked paprika
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• 2 tbsp bacon drippings from cooked bacon

Instructions

  1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add 8 oz rotini pasta and cook according to package instructions, usually 8-10 minutes, until al dente.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king. Drain the pasta and rinse briefly under cold water to stop the cooking process and cool it down. Set aside to drain completely.
  2. While the pasta cooks, heat a skillet over medium heat. Add 6 slices thick-cut bacon and cook until crispy, about 5-7 minutes, turning occasionally. Remove bacon and place on paper towels to drain excess grease. Reserve 2 tablespoons of the bacon drippings from the pan for the dressing.
  3. In a small bowl, whisk together ½ cup mayonnaise, ¼ cup sour cream, 2 tbsp buttermilk, reserved bacon drippings, 1 tsp garlic powder, 1 tsp onion powder, 1 tsp dried dill, 1 tsp fresh parsley, and ½ tsp smoked paprika.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Add a splash more buttermilk if dressing is too thick.
  4. Halve 2 cups of cherry tomatoes, finely dice ½ cup red onion, and chop 1 cup romaine lettuce. If using cheddar, shred about 1 cup.
  5. In a large bowl, toss the drained pasta, chopped veggies, crumbled crispy bacon, and shredded cheddar cheese. Pour the bacon ranch dressing over the top and fold gently until everything is evenly coated.
  6. Let the salad ch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ed before serving.

Notes

Rinse pasta after cooking to prevent sogginess. Use freshly cooked bacon and reserve drippings for dressing to add smoky depth. Chill salad for at least 30 minutes before serving to meld flavors. Add fresh veggies like lettuce and tomatoes just before serving to keep crisp. Dressing can be loosened with extra buttermilk if too thick.
